Помогите подобрать компоненты для отправки команд с Arduino через com порт на др. устройства
- Войдите на сайт для отправки комментариев
Ср, 29/05/2019 - 11:27
Добрый день,
Лень двигатель не только прогресса но и саморазвития =)
С ардуино мало знаком, по этому не хотел бы платить дважды за те компоненты которые пока не нужны для первого проекта.
Прошу помочь с подбором модели Arduino для выполнения следующих манипуляций:
Имеется набором команд (конфиг), в котором для залития на следующие устройство требуется смена нескольких значений (переменные).
Хотелось бы менять эти переменные с кнопок на корпусе (с экраном).
Основные команды и команды с измененными данными,будут заливаться на устройство через com(консольный) порт.
Заранее спасибо за подсказки!
ничего не получится
вы "С ардуино мало знаком" на столько, что то, что вы хотите сделать у вас однозначно не получится.
вам для начала надо почитать справочники и посмотреть примеры....
и начать с простого - помигать светодиодом... добавить кнопочку для его включения ... и тд
потом чтото простое из библиотек - например натидребезг для кнопочки...
потом уже смотреть на доп моодулил - тотже экран... и его библиотеки - вывести что-нибуть на него...
...
в общем учитесь - иначе вас быстро пошлют в коммерческий раздел...
Любая, если кнопок меньше чем 19.
Вы распишите подробно как вы это всё видите - что загружаете с КОМ-а, какой экран, что на экране, как хотелось бы изменять, как сохранять...
Что такое ком порт? Это честный rs232, usb, TTL, rs485 или какая то другая экзотика??
Сколько кнопок надо и для чего? Это может быть одна кнопка - один конфиг. Или меню выбора на двух кнопках и третья кнопка отсылки?
Экран какой 2х16 цифровой или oled графический?
Тщательнее ТЗ надо писать. По Вашему описанию только вопросы пока есть.
Спасибо всем за отзывчивость!
Понятное дело, что все будет делаться постепенно начиная с моргания лампочкой =)
Самым простым исполнением вижу следующее использование:
В память ардуино залит набор строчек с командами
Часть строчек будут с переменными
Корпус с несколькими кнопками и небольшим экраном, достаточно однострочного
Для начала, буду менять только цифровые переменные, до 3-4х символов в переменной (может будут буквенные, но это пока лишнее)
Будут кнопки вперед-назад или под конретную переменную, для переключаться между ними 1-2-3-4-5-1
Кнопки вверх-вниз для ввода цифр в поле переменная, которое отображается на экране.
После занесения данных, при на жатии на кнопку, ардуино шлет строки с данными на оборудование по "честному" RS-232.
Тогда нано, 4 тактовые кнопки, дисплей LCD16X2, TTL-RS232 адаптер. Ногу Тх адаптера и Rx наны соединить через 1кОм. Для програмирования обработки кнопок есть тема титановый велосипед. Остальное програмируется просто, по примерам среды.
Спасибо! Начало положено!